General Responsibilities:
- Responsible for ensuring Simply Solar systems are operating and maintained as intended in a safe and efficient manner.
- Coordinate and perform pre-energization, commissioning, warranty repairs, and manage technical and field support.
- Promote a positive company image through service quality, professionalism, and a strong sense of urgency.
- Recruit, train and manage departmental staff.
- Provide constructive and timely performance evaluations.
- Draft, implement, and execute policies and procedures to ensure quality post-installation customer service.
- Establish service standards and requirements for the department.
- Develop and implement methods to record, assess, and analyze client feedback.
- Develop and implement training and quality assurance programs for the Client Service team.
- Identify and recommend expansions to technology and equipment that may improve customer service and retention.
Daily Duties:
- Oversee the daily workflow of the department, including scheduling and dispatching maintenance crew members.
- Provide leadership to the Client Services Administrator and Maintenance crew members.
- Act as a liaison between the Client Service Department and other divisions in the company.
- Manage and maintain work schedule and three week look-ahead, providing frequent reports of job status to the Director of Operations.
- Coordinate and/or respond to Service calls as dispatched.
- Troubleshoot problems in photovoltaic inverters and monitoring.
- Review project plans, specifications, and installation instructions to ensure that the project is built according to the approved design and specifications.
- Coordinate additional help for field work as needed.
- Track progress of cases and log communications with clients and manufacturers in CRM.
- Work with OEMs to determine warranty status of installed equipment.
- Fill out Service Work Orders to track travel, labor time, and materials used.

Requirements:
- Strong understanding of grid-tied, off-grid and hybrid PV system design and installation, commissioning procedures, shut down/LOTO procedures, programming, troubleshooting, monitoring, and repair.
- Excellent interpersonal skills and strong attention to detail.
- Excellent critical thinking and organizational skills.
- 1+ year minimum experience in solar industry
- Bachelor’s degree in engineering or related field preferred.
- Industrial communications and networking knowledge, including wired and wireless networks and system topologies.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Proficient with GSuite, Salesforce and related software.
- This job operates in a professional office environment. The role routinely uses standard office equipment such as computers, phones, and copiers.
- Must be able to remain in a stationary position and operate a computer for long periods of time.
- Must be able to transport materials and equipment to complete assigned job tasks: up to 50 pounds individually, and up to 100 pounds with assistance
